Villarreal Coach Hails 30M Euros Rated Chukwueze : He Had A Great Game, An Important Player
Published: December 02, 2018
Villarreal coach Javi Calleja faced the cameras shortly after his side's 2-0 loss to Barcelona at the Camp Nou and reserved special praise for teenage Nigeria international Samuel Chukwueze.
While Barcelona winger Ousmane Dembélé created the most problems for Villarreal, the Azulgranas failed to keep the tricky Chukwueze under wraps for most part of the game.
''Dembélé today has been very difficult to stop. He is a player who has huge qualities. We came to the Camp Nou to win,'' Calleja said at the post-match press conference.
''We've competed very well. We can't lower our heads. We are very happy with the work done.''
On Chukwueze, Javi Calleja said : ''Samu (Chukwueze) had a great match. He is growing. He is a more and more important player. He is young and confident, he'll end up learning a lot.''
Javi Calleja set up his team in a 4-2-3-1 formation, with Chukwueze operating from the right flank.
The Diamond Academy product is already putting himself in the shop window and will cost interested clubs 30 million euros, the release clause inserted into his contract in the summer.
